Home
last modified time | relevance | path

Searched refs:IsScalar (Results 1 – 10 of 10)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/CodeGenTypes/
H A DLowLevelType.h141 : IsScalar(false), IsPointer(false), IsVector(false), RawData(0) {} in LLT()
145 constexpr bool isValid() const { return IsScalar || RawData != 0; } in isValid()
146 constexpr bool isScalar() const { return IsScalar; } in isScalar()
147 constexpr bool isToken() const { return IsScalar && RawData == 0; }; in isToken()
268 if (IsScalar) in getScalarSizeInBits()
306 IsScalar == RHS.IsScalar && RHS.RawData == RawData;
394 uint64_t IsScalar : 1;
417 constexpr void init(bool IsPointer, bool IsVector, bool IsScalar,
424 this->IsScalar = IsScalar;
425 if (IsScalar)
[all …]
/freebsd/contrib/llvm-project/llvm/lib/CodeGenTypes/
H A DLowLevelType.cpp31 IsScalar = false; in LLT()
/fre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/
H A DRISCVGatherScatterLowering.cpp357 auto IsScalar = [](Value *Idx) { return !Idx->getType()->isVectorTy(); }; in determineBaseAndStride() local
358 if (all_of(GEP->indices(), IsScalar)) { in determineBaseAndStride()
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/
H A DVPlan.h284 Value *get(VPValue *Def, unsigned Part, bool IsScalar = false);
307 void set(VPValue *Def, Value *V, unsigned Part, bool IsScalar = false) {
308 if (IsScalar) {
H A DLoopVectorize.cpp5273 bool IsScalar = all_of(Inst->users(), [&](User *U) { in calculateRegisterUsage() local
5279 ElementCount VF = IsScalar ? ElementCount::getFixed(1) : VFs[i]; in calculateRegisterUsage()
/fre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DSIFoldOperands.cpp1171 static unsigned getMovOpc(bool IsScalar) { in getMovOpc() argument
1172 return IsScalar ? AMDGPU::S_MOV_B32 : AMDGPU::V_MOV_B32_e32; in getMovOpc()
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DAutoUpgrade.cpp3560 bool IsScalar = NegMul ? Name[12] == 's' : Name[11] == 's'; in upgradeX86IntrinsicCall() local
3565 if (IsScalar) { in upgradeX86IntrinsicCall()
3571 if (NegMul && !IsScalar) in upgradeX86IntrinsicCall()
3573 if (NegMul && IsScalar) in upgradeX86IntrinsicCall()
3583 if (IsScalar) in upgradeX86IntrinsicCall()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GDecl.cpp2607 bool IsScalar = hasScalarEvaluationKind(Ty); in EmitParmDecl() local
2681 if (IsScalar) { in EmitParmDecl()
H A DMicrosoftCXXABI.cpp4226 bool IsScalar = !RD; in getCatchableType() local
4241 if (IsScalar) in getCatchableType()
/freebsd/contrib/llvm-project/clang/include/clang/Basic/
H A DTokenKinds.def578 TYPE_TRAIT_1(__is_scalar, IsScalar, KEYCXX)